The Mahabharata, written by Sage Ved Vyasa, is the longest epic poem ever written in the history of the world. However, 'Mahabharata' was not its original name. Let's look at its true historical title.
Original Name: Jaya (or Jaya Samhita).
Author: Sage Ved Vyasa.
Size: The current Mahabharata has over 100,000 verses (Shlokas), making it the longest epic in the world.
When Sage Vyasa first dictated the epic to Lord Ganesha, it was much shorter (about 8,800 verses).
Later, as Vyasa's disciples (like Vaishampayana) added more stories, moral lessons, and legends to it, it grew to 24,000 verses and was called 'Bharata'. Eventually, it expanded to 100,000 verses, covering the entire history of the Kuru dynasty and the geography of ancient India, and finally became known as the 'Mahabharata'.
